WISDOM TO CREATE A LIFE OF PASSION, PURPOSE, AND PEACE. This inspiring tale provides a step-by-step approach to living with greater courage, balance, abundance, and joy. A wonderfully crafted fable, The Monk Who Sold His Ferrari tells the extraordinary story of Julian Mantle, a lawyer forced to confront the spiritual crisis of his out-of-balance life. On a life-changing odyssey to an ancient culture, he discovers powerful, wise, and practical lessons that teach us to: - Develop joyful thoughts - Follow our life's mission and calling - Cultivate self-discipline and act courageously - Value time as our most important commodity - Nourish our relationships, and - live fully, one day at a time
